                        From Hull KR website;

                        Andrew Webster has left the Robins’ coaching staff to head home to Australia, whilst Chris Chester will continue in his role as Assistant Coach having agreed a year’s extension to his contract.

                        Webster leaves the club after six years of loyal service to take up a job in the NRL with the Wests Tigers and since arriving at Craven Park ahead of the 2006 season had become an integral part of the backroom staff.

                        His debut campaign with the Robins ended in fairytale circumstances as the club were promoted into Super League following the National League Grand Final victory over Widnes.

                        That fairytale has been followed up with plenty of highlights over the past five seasons and Webster admitted that it was a tough call to head back Down Under.

                        “I’m excited about the future, but I’m sad to be leaving Rovers,” he said. "I left on good terms and while they wanted me to stay, this is too good an opportunity to pass up. I’ve had an amazing time at Rovers but it’s time for me to move on.

                        “I’m going to be helping out with Wests Tigers academy system and their elite kids. They are two different games in Australia and England but I’m looking forward to getting started. It’s something I’ve done well at Hull KR and it’s a step towards becoming a head coach one day.”

                        Rovers’ CEO, Mike Smith, is disappointed to see Webster depart and said:

                        "Andrew has been a very loyal servant to Hull KR over the last six years and we’re very sad to see him go. He was there when we got into Super League and has remained with us during the last five years which have seen the club make massive strides. Andrew has played a big part in that and will always be a part of the club’s history.

                        “The opportunity for him to go and coach at Wests Tigers is a brilliant one for him and he leaves Craven Park with our gratitude for what he’s done and our very best wishes for the future.”

                        One person who won’t be leaving is Assistant Coach, Chris Chester, who has extended his deal for a further year.

                        Having represented the Robins as a player during 2007 and 2008 before injury forced his early retirement from the game, Chester joined Castleford’s coaching staff before returning to Craven Park in the Assistant Coach’s role ahead of the 2009 season.

                        He’ll work alongside new Head Coach, Craig Sandercock, as the club head into 2012.
